Partager via


Propriété TextRange2.Characters (Office)

En lecture seule.

Syntaxe

expression. Caractères (Début, Longueur)

expression Expression qui renvoie un objet TextRange2 .

Paramètres

Nom Requis/Facultatif Type de données Description
Start Facultatif Long Premier caractère de la plage renvoyée.
Longueur Facultatif Long Nombre de caractères à renvoyer.

Valeur renvoyée

TextRange2

Remarques

Si start et length sont omis, la plage retournée commence par le premier caractère et se termine par le dernier paragraphe de la plage spécifiée.

Si Start est spécifié, mais que Length est omis, la plage retournée contient un caractère.

Si Length est spécifié, mais que Start est omis, la plage retournée commence par le premier caractère de la plage spécifiée.

Si la valeur de l’argument Début est supérieure au nombre de caractères du texte spécifié, la plage renvoyée commence par le dernier caractère de la plage spécifiée.

Si la valeur de l’argument Longueur est supérieure au nombre de caractères à partir du caractère de départ spécifié jusqu’à la fin du texte, la plage renvoyée contient tous ces caractères.

Exemple

Cet exemple montre comment définir le texte de la forme 2 de la diapositive 1 de la présentation active, puis définir le deuxième caractère en indice avec un décalage de 20 %.

Dim charRange As TextRange2 
With Application.ActivePresentation.Slides(1).Shapes(2) 
 Set charRange = .TextFrame.TextRange2.InsertBefore("H2O") 
 charRange.Characters(2).Font.BaselineOffset = -0.2 
End With 

Voir aussi

Assistance et commentaires

Avez-vous des questions ou des commentaires sur Office VBA ou sur cette documentation ? Consultez la rubrique concernant l’assistance pour Office VBA et l’envoi de commentaires afin d’obtenir des instructions pour recevoir une assistance et envoyer vos commentaires.